Automated billing machines are integral components in modern transaction processing, offering a seamless and efficient way to handle payments and invoicing. These devices are commonly utilized in various commercial settings, streamlining the checkout process and enhancing customer service.
There is a diverse range of automated billing systems designed to cater to different business needs. Some are equipped with advanced features like inventory management and sales reporting, while others focus on basic transaction processing. Key features to consider include user-friendliness, compatibility with different payment methods, and the ability to integrate with other business systems.
Automated billing machines are versatile and can be found in retail, hospitality, and healthcare, among other industries. They are designed to handle high volumes of transactions with precision, ensuring that the billing process is both accurate and swift, which is crucial in fast-paced business environments.
The construction of automated billing machines often involves robust materials that can withstand the rigors of frequent use. Durability is a key consideration, as these machines are critical to daily operations and need to remain reliable over time.
Employing automated billing solutions can lead to significant improvements in efficiency and accuracy. They reduce human error, save time during the transaction process, and can provide valuable analytics to aid in business decision-making. Additionally, they offer a level of customer service that can enhance the overall shopping experience.
When choosing an automated billing machine, it's important to consider the specific needs of your business, including transaction volume, required features, and compatibility with existing systems. A thorough assessment will help ensure that the selected machine aligns with your operational requirements.
